dnet45dhp-schemasdnet-hadoopdnet40dnet50
Clean up code use only the method to get managers without session cookieadd more checks if community is enabled for notifications or not
temporal fix for log4j build fail
get managers list: update the methods - add new properties
[Trunk | Claims Service]:1. Metrics.java: New entity for Metrics.2. MetricsHandler.java: Handler for metrics to create queries via QueryGenerator for saving and fetching metrics and execute them.3. QueryGenerator.java: Queries for metrics added (not all of them are used - created for testing)....
[Trunk | Claims Service]:1. springContext-claims.properties: Updated "services.claims.mail.openaireCommunityClaimsPage" and "services.claims.mail.manageCommunityUserNotificationsPage" to use the new admin portal urls (Admin portal redesign).2. EmailSender.java: Build urls by replacing "{community}" with openaire_id in "openaireCommunityClaimsPage" and "manageCommunityUserNotificationsPage" properties, (Admin portal redesign - new urls).
[Trunk | Claims Service]:1. ManagerUtils.java: Added method "isCommunityManager()" to check if a user_email is among managers of a community.2. springContext-claims.xml: Added in bean with id=emailSender, property name="managerUtils" and removed property name="communityUtils".
[Trunk | Claims Service]:1. ManagerUtils.java: [NEW] File for getting community managers from registry service added.2. springContext-claims.properties: Property "services.claims.registryAPIForManagerEmails" added - URL of registry service for requesting community manager emails....
Updates to Migrate community claims from Beta to Production
CommunityUtils: chnage methods from static, add it with autowired in EmailSender update properties
Update email Sender and Scheduler:
rename property emailScheduler.sendEmailNotifications to services.claims.mail.sendEmailNotifications
Add properties to enable/disable notifications for specific entities: services.claims.mail.notifyCommunityManagers services.claims.mail.notifyProjectManagers
Fix1: set type after parsing response from external sources - this fix puts the record in the proper file path
Fix2: Update orcid parser, use single orcid work response update ExternalParserTest
View revisions
Also available in: Atom